深入解析SSL证书信息保障网站安全的核心要素
海外云服务器 40个地区可选 亚太云服务器 香港 日本 韩国
云虚拟主机 个人和企业网站的理想选择 俄罗斯电商外贸虚拟主机 赠送SSL证书
美国云虚拟主机 助力出海企业低成本上云 WAF网站防火墙 为您的业务网站保驾护航
在当今数字化时代,网络安全已成为互联网用户与企业共同关注的核心议题,随着网络攻击、数据泄露等安全事件频繁发生,如何保障用户与服务器之间的通信安全,已成为技术演进的关键方向之一,SSL(Secure Sockets Layer,安全套接层)证书作为实现加密传输的核心技术工具,其重要性不言而喻,本文将深入解析SSL证书的构成、功能、类型及其管理方式,帮助读者全面掌握相关知识,从而为网站安全构筑坚实防线。
SSL证书是一种数字凭证,用于在客户端(如浏览器)与服务器之间建立安全的加密连接,确保数据在传输过程中的机密性、完整性和身份真实性,当用户访问一个启用SSL的网站时(通常以“https://”开头),浏览器会自动验证该网站的SSL证书,并利用其中的公钥进行加密通信,这一机制有效抵御了中间人攻击、数据窃听和篡改等常见威胁,是现代网络安全体系的重要基石。
随着TLS(Transport Layer Security,传输层安全性协议)逐步取代SSL成为主流标准,尽管人们仍习惯称之为“SSL证书”,实际上大多数系统已采用更安全的TLS协议运行,严格意义上应称为“TLS证书”,但出于通用习惯,本文沿用“SSL证书”这一术语。
SSL证书的信息构成
SSL证书并非简单的加密开关,而是一个结构严谨、信息丰富的数字文件,遵循X.509国际标准格式,它包含了多个关键字段,每一个都承担着特定的安全职责,以下是SSL证书中常见的核心信息:
-
域名(Common Name, CN)
这是证书绑定的主要域名,www.example.com
,若用户访问的域名与证书中的CN不一致,浏览器将触发安全警告,对于通配符证书(如*.example.com
),可覆盖同一主域下的所有子域名。 -
签发机构(Issuer)
即证书颁发机构(Certificate Authority, CA),是受广泛信任的第三方组织,负责审核申请者的身份并签发合法证书,知名CA包括 DigiCert、GlobalSign、Sectigo 以及免费服务提供者 Let's Encrypt,浏览器内置了对这些权威CA的信任根列表,只有由可信CA签发的证书才能被自动识别为安全。 -
有效期(Validity Period)
每张SSL证书都有明确的有效期限,传统商业证书一般为1至2年,而像Let's Encrypt这样的自动化CA则提供90天短期证书,鼓励定期更新以提升安全性,一旦证书过期,连接将被视为不可信,可能导致服务中断或用户流失。 -
公钥信息(Public Key)
公钥是加密通信的基础,嵌入于证书中供客户端使用;对应的私钥则保存在服务器端,用于解密数据,目前主流算法包括RSA(常为2048位或更高)和ECC(椭圆曲线加密),后者在同等安全强度下具有更高的效率和更小的密钥体积。 -
序列号(Serial Number)
由CA分配的唯一标识符,用于追踪和管理每一张证书的生命周期,在吊销查询(CRL/OCSP)中起关键作用。 -
指纹(Fingerprint)
指纹是证书内容经过哈希运算后生成的摘要值(常用SHA-256),可用于快速比对证书是否被篡改或伪造,管理员可通过指纹校验来确认远程服务器提供的证书是否真实可信。 -
扩展信息(Extensions)
包含多项增强功能字段,- Subject Alternative Names (SAN):支持多个域名或子域名,适用于多站点部署。
- Key Usage / Extended Key Usage:定义证书用途,如仅用于服务器认证或代码签名。
- Basic Constraints:标明该证书是否可用于签发其他子证书(常用于中间CA)。
SSL证书的类型
根据验证等级和适用范围的不同,SSL证书可分为多种类型,满足不同场景的安全需求:
按验证级别分类:
-
DV证书(Domain Validation)
仅验证申请者对域名的所有权,签发速度快、成本低,适合个人博客、测试环境或小型项目,但由于不包含组织信息,信任度相对较低。 -
OV证书(Organization Validation)
在域名验证基础上,还需提交企业营业执照、注册信息等资料,经CA人工审核通过后签发,证书中会显示单位名称,适用于中型企业和注重品牌信誉的网站。 -
EV证书(Extended Validation)
验证最为严格,需经过详尽的企业背景调查和法律合规审查,启用后,浏览器地址栏会显示绿色公司名称及锁形图标,显著增强用户信任感,广泛应用于银行、金融平台、电商平台等高敏感业务场景。
⚠️ 注:近年来部分浏览器已弱化EV证书的视觉展示(如不再突出显示绿色栏),但其背后的高验证标准依然具备更高的安全价值。
按保护范围分类:
- 单域名证书:仅保护一个具体域名(如
example.com
)。 - 多域名证书(SAN证书):可同时保护多个完全不同的域名(如
example.com
,shop.net
,blog.org
),便于统一管理多个业务入口。 - 通配符证书(Wildcard Certificate):支持主域名及其所有一级子域名(如
*.example.com
可涵盖mail.example.com
、admin.example.com
等),特别适合拥有大量子系统的大型架构。
如何查看SSL证书信息?
普通用户和系统管理员均可通过多种方式查看SSL证书的详细内容:
-
浏览器查看方法:
在Chrome、Firefox、Edge等主流浏览器中,点击地址栏的“锁”图标 → 选择“连接是安全的”→ 查看证书,即可浏览证书的颁发者、有效期、域名、指纹等基本信息。 -
命令行工具分析:
使用OpenSSL工具可深入解析本地证书文件:openssl x509 -in certificate.crt -text -noout
此命令将输出完整的证书结构,适合运维人员进行调试与审计。
-
在线检测工具:
借助SSL Labs(https://www.SSLlabs.com/ssltest/)等专业平台,可以全面评估网站的SSL配置质量,包括协议支持、加密套件强度、是否存在漏洞等。
SSL证书的重要性与未来发展趋势
SSL证书不仅是技术防护手段,更是构建数字信任生态的关键环节,谷歌早在2014年便宣布将HTTPS作为搜索引擎排名因子之一,未启用SSL的网站不仅面临安全风险,还可能遭遇SEO降权和流量下滑。“全站HTTPS”已成为现代网站的基本标配。
HTTP/2 和 HTTP/3 协议均要求基于TLS加密连接才能启用,这意味着即使静态资源站点也必须部署SSL证书,否则无法享受新协议带来的性能优化。
展望未来,SSL证书的发展呈现以下趋势:
-
自动化管理普及化:
ACME协议(Automated Certificate Management Environment)推动了证书申请、续期、部署的全流程自动化,以Let's Encrypt为代表的免费CA极大降低了中小开发者的技术门槛,实现“零成本”安全升级。 -
短期证书常态化:
出于安全考虑,行业正趋向于采用更短有效期的证书(如90天甚至更短),结合自动续签机制,减少因证书过期导致的服务中断风险。 -
抗量子加密前瞻布局:
随着量子计算技术的进步,传统RSA/ECC算法面临潜在破解威胁,NIST正在推进后量子密码学(PQC)标准化进程,预计未来几年将出现支持抗量子算法的新一代数字证书,提前应对未来的安全挑战。 -
零信任架构中的角色强化:
在“永不信任,始终验证”的零信任安全模型中,SSL/TLS证书不仅是传输加密工具,还可作为设备或服务身份认证的一部分,融入整体身份治理体系。
SSL证书信息是理解网络安全机制的重要切入点,掌握其结构组成、类型差异与管理实践,不仅能帮助网站运营者有效防范数据泄露和劫持风险,更能提升用户体验与品牌公信力,在日益复杂的网络环境中,正确配置、及时更新并妥善管理SSL证书,已成为每个网站不可或缺的安全基础。
无论是个人博客、初创项目,还是大型电商平台,都应高度重视SSL证书的应用,将其视为网络安全的第一道防线,唯有筑牢这一底层屏障,方能在数字浪潮中稳健前行,赢得用户的长久信赖。